ajax实现不刷新下拉加载更多
JS代码
$(函数(){())
var页面= 1;
VaR的折扣(#美元折扣);
无功innerheight = window.innerheight;
VaR Timer2 = null;
$ ajax({
网址: / / /验证lightapp营销 /申请/列表页面= 1,
类型:' ',
DataType:'json,
超时:'1000,
缓存:假,
成功:函数(数据){
如果(data.error_code = 0){
无功arrtext = { };
对于(var i = 0,t;T =数据。列表{ + };){
ArrText.push();
ArrText.push(+ t.title +);
如果(t.coupon_type = = 1){
ArrText.push('amount:$'+ t.amount +);
{人}
ArrText.push('concession t.amount:+ +);
}
ArrText.push(用户的账户:是啊t.user_name + 12 ++时间:+ t.use_time +);
ArrText.push();
}
discount.html(arrtext.join('));
};
无功ajax_getting = false;
$(窗口)。滚动(函数(){)
ClearTimeout(定时器);
Timer2 = setTimeout(){()函数(
VaR scrollTop = $(document。体)ScrollTop();
scrollheight = $(var 'body)。Height();
无功windowheight = innerheight;
无功scrollwhole = math.max(scrollheight - scrollTop - windowheight);
如果(scrollwhole<100){
如果(ajax_getting){
返回false;
{人}
ajax_getting =真;
}
discount.append(' ');
('html美元,身体)。ScrollTop($(窗口),Height()+ $(document)。Height());
页+;
$ ajax({
网址: / / /验证lightapp营销 /申请/列表页面=+页,
类型:' ',
DataType:'json,
成功:函数(数据){
如果(data.error_code = 0){
无功arrtext = { };
对于(var i = 0,t;T =数据。列表{ + };){
ArrText.push();
ArrText.push(+ t.title +);
如果(t.coupon_type = = 1){
ArrText.push('amount:$'+ t.amount +);
{人}
ArrText.push('concession t.amount:+ +);
};
ArrText.push(用户帐户:111111111 + SA的t.user_name ++时间:+ t.use_time +);
ArrText.push();
}
discount.append(arrtext.join('));
$();
{人}
$();
discount.append(没有更多的数据。);
$(窗口)Unbind('scroll);
};
ajax_getting = false;
}
});
};
$();
},200);
});
如果(data.error_code = = 156006){
美元(优惠券)Html(错误)!原因:未登录)
};
如果(data.error_code = = 156003){
美元(优惠券)Html(错误)!原因:缺乏权威,请加上
};
如果(data.error_code = = 156007){
美元(优惠券)Html(错误)!原因:服务异常)
};
如果(data.error_code = = 511){
美元(优惠券)Html(错误)!原因:帐号不开放号码
};
如果(data.error_code = = 520){
$(优惠券)Html(没有注销记录)
}
},
错误:函数(数据){
}
})
$(窗口),Bind(orientationchange
$('。滑块)。Css(右,$(窗口),Width()/ 2 + 'px);
})
})
以上是本文的全部内容,希望大家能喜欢。